问答详情
源自:3-7 jQuery的属性与样式之样式操作.css()

return (Number(value[0]) + 50) + value[1];中的Number是jq里的字符转化成数字的写法吗

Number类似于js中的parseInt吗

提问者:李松强 2018-07-01 16:21

个回答

  • 精慕门3809150
    2018-07-02 21:04:25

    是的,因为split划分之后是有两个字符串元素的数组,第一个字符串是一串数字,第二个是px。用Number可以将第一个数字字符串转换成数字拼接之后返回。

    Number():可以用于任何数据类型转换成数值,只转换成十进制,比较万能,比如布尔可以转换成0或者1.

    parseInt()专门用于把字符串转换成数值;